WebA grape is a fruit, botanically a berry, of the deciduous woody vines of the flowering plant genus Vitis.Grapes are a non-climacteric type of fruit, generally occurring in clusters.The cultivation of grapes began perhaps 8,000 years ago, and the fruit has been used as human food over history.
